IMPORTANT SAFETY INSTRUCTIONS
FOR ALL ELECTRIC TOOLS
When using electric tools, basic safety precautions
should always be followed to reduce risk of fire,
electric shock, personal injury and the like, including
the following.
(1) Keep work area clean.
・
Cluttered work areas and benches invite accidents and
injuries.
(2) Consider work area environment.
・
Do not expose tools to rain. Do not use tools in damp or
wet locations.
・
Keep work area well lit.
・
Do not operate near flammable liquids or in gaseous or
explosive atmospheres.
(3) Check the Power Source
・
Operate under the power source the voltage fluctuating
rate of which is within
±
10% of the rated voltage, and
the frequency of which is 50/60Hz of sinusoidal wave.
(4) Be cautious about electric shock.
・
When using electric tools, do not touch any which is
earthed. (Ex. Pipe, heating apparatus, microwave oven,
outside frame of refrigerator)
(5) Keep children away.
・
Also all visitors should be kept away from work area.
・
Do not let visitors contact the tool, or connecting cords.
(6) Store idle tools.
・
When not in use, tools should be stored in dry, and
locked-up places out of reach of children.
(7) Do not force tool.
・
It will do the job better and safer at the rate which it
was designed.
(8) Use right tool.
・
Do not force a small tool of attachment to do the job of
a heavy-duty tool.
・
Do not use tool for a purpose not intended.
(9) Dress properly.
2
・
Do not wear loose clothing or accessories. They can
be caught in moving parts.
・
Rubber gloves and Non-skid footwear are recommended.
・
Wear protective hair covering to contain long hair.
(10) Always wear eye protection.
・
Everyday eyeglasses only have impact resistant lenses.
They do NOT protect eyes. Also use face or dust mask,
if operations create dust.
(11) Do not abuse cable.
・
Never carry tool by connecting cable or yankit to
disconnect from receptacle.
・
Do not place a cable near a place with high heat, oil,
and sharp edge.
(12) Secure work.
・
Use clamps or a vise to hold work when practical.
・
It is safer than using your hand and it frees both hands
to operate tool.
(13) Do not overreach.
・
Keep proper footing and balance at all times.
(14) Cautious maintenance is necessary for electric
tools.
・
Always maintain blades and keep it work well so that
safe and efficient work can be done.
・
Follow the instruction manual for oiling or change of
accessories.
・
Check the cable regularly. Contact the sales agents
to repair it when it is defective.
・
When an extension cable is used, check regularly and
change it when it is damaged.
・
The grip should be kept dry and clean. Maintain it so
well that it does not carry oil or grease.
(15) Switch off and take off the plug for the following:
・
Not in use.
・
When you change blades, grinding stone and bit.
・
Any danger is anticipated.
(16) Remove spanners, wrenches etc., after adjustment.
・
Make sure that spanners, wrenches etc., which are
used for adjustment are removed before switching on.
(17) Always avoid unexpected start.
・
Do not carry the tool with a finger on the switch when
the power supply is on.
Make sure that the switch is off before plugging in.
